3. Overlooking Two-Factor Authentication

Many players underestimate the importance of two-factor authentication (2FA). Not enabling it is like leaving your house unlocked. By activating 2FA, you add an extra layer of security to your account. LevelUp Casino offers this feature, so make sure you use it. It typically involves receiving a code via SMS or email, which you’ll need to enter along with your password.

6. Using Weak Passwords

If your password is “password123,” you might as well be inviting trouble. Using weak passwords is a rookie mistake. Aim for a mix of letters, numbers, and symbols. LevelUp Casino recommends changing your password regularly, and it’s a good idea to use a password manager to keep track of your secure logins.
